Send me a text In Part 1B of our exploration of the Italian preposition a, it's time to put everything into practice. --> Link to Post for Transcript for this episode <-- We'll discover how a combines with definite articles to form al, allo, alla, all', ai, agli, and alle, and we'll meet a family of common verbs that naturally take a, including provare a, riuscire a, cominciare a, continuare a, and imparare a.
